By Emmanuel Ssejjengo

The long awaited South African music sensation, Dr. Victor, on Thursday arrived in the country amidst excitement from his fans.

He arrived aboard Kenyan airways with his Rasta rebels crew who included Winston Dlamini, George Longane and Petrus Williams. The group will perform today at Lugogo Cricket ground.

They were received by Uganda Breweries officials and later hosted to a party at Capital gardens.

Dr. Victor said he was happy to be back in Uganda and urged his fans to expect ‘fire works’.

The party was attended by local artistes, including Bebe Cool, Emperor Orlando and overzealous Capital FM fans.

When Dr. Victor stepped onto the podium, it was screams for the few that were invited. He simply waved to the crowd and did a jig of his song with Capital FM presenter Olanya Colombus.

That was it. So, when he turned to the gate, many followed.
